Jump to content

Ubilling + NAS на FreeBSD бортжурнал починаючого адміна


Recommended Posts

 

 

у мене щось таке вискочило після розвертання дампу бази даних . і заміни alter.ini

База з старої установки з 2.408, нє?

ALTER TABLE tariffs ADD period VARCHAR(32) NOT NULL DEFAULT 'month'
Link to post
Share on other sites
  • Replies 1.8k
  • Created
  • Last Reply

Top Posters In This Topic

Top Posters In This Topic

Popular Posts

Вітаю Татко!   

Не так вже й багато   Ход коньом:   # cat /bin/clear_dhcpdlog #!/bin/sh /bin/echo > /var/log/dhcpd.log /usr/local/etc/rc.d/isc-dhcpd restart # chmod a+x /bin/clear_dhcpdlog # crontab -e

http://wiki.ubilling.net.ua/doku.php?id=userstats       Расист? http://wiki.ubilling.net.ua/doku.php?id=userstats

Posted Images

 

у мене щось таке вискочило після розвертання дампу бази даних . і заміни alter.ini

База з старої установки з 2.408, нє?

ALTER TABLE tariffs ADD period VARCHAR(32) NOT NULL DEFAULT 'month'

так . дякую працює . 

Edited by kissbohda
Link to post
Share on other sites

Здравствуйте.

Спасибо за отличный продукт!

Подскажите:

Cвязка ESXI (freebsd+routeros).

В ubilling`е, раздел NASы.

 

Микротик одна шт. 10.0.3.254/24

Фряха  em1 10.0.3.15/24.

 

Абоненты в 172.17.0.0./16

 

Вопрос. NAS добавлять же один раз для любой подсети? Т.е. один раз добавил для любой подсети, например 172,17,0,1/24, и nas 10.0.3.254 и дальше можно много сетей в dhcp юбилинга делать?

Либо же для каждой подсети(хотя они 172.17), писать каждый раз айпи NASа(10,0,3)?

 

 

 

И ещё кое что., у меня в в неизвестных маках  - мак адреса этих же сетевых карт, на которых подняты интерфейсы фряхи.

Не могу что-то определить куда их?

Edited by Qvent
Link to post
Share on other sites

 

 

например 172,17,0,1/24, и nas 10.0.3.254 и дальше можно много сетей в dhcp юбилинга делать?

а смисл?

 

робите 172.17.0.0/22 і маєте 1000 адрес для абонентів

ваш тік їх потягне?

 

 

 

Либо же для каждой подсети(хотя они 172.17), писать каждый раз айпи NASа(10,0,3)?

мммм  поюзайте сетевой калькулятор 

172.17.0.0/24 і 172.17.0.0/16 різницю бачите?

255 хостів       і 255*255 хостів

 

одна підмережа 1 нас

треба ще одна підмережа? то вказуйте на якому НАС вона у вас живе.

Link to post
Share on other sites

Дякую за вiдповiдь.

Декiлька DHCP по /24 замiсть одного /16 потрiбно, щоб була хоча б якась структура розподiлу IP адресiв (наприклад 1.0 для вулицi Артема, 2.0 для Пушкина и т.д.)

 

 

 

З Вашоi вiдповiдi, ще раз зрозумiв, що навiть якщо в мене декiлька пiдмереж, та "фiзично" усього один NAS, то я кожен раз буду його вказувати. В цiлому, у Допомозi ubilling також так вказано.

Дякую.

 

например 172,17,0,1/24, и nas 10.0.3.254 и дальше можно много сетей в dhcp юбилинга делать?

а смисл?

 

робите 172.17.0.0/22 і маєте 1000 адрес для абонентів

ваш тік їх потягне?

 

 

 

Либо же для каждой подсети(хотя они 172.17), писать каждый раз айпи NASа(10,0,3)?

мммм  поюзайте сетевой калькулятор

172.17.0.0/24 і 172.17.0.0/16 різницю бачите?

255 хостів       і 255*255 хостів

 

одна підмережа 1 нас

треба ще одна підмережа? то вказуйте на якому НАС вона у вас живе.

 

 

 

 

Питання про MAC-адресу ще актуальне!!

Edited by Qvent
Link to post
Share on other sites

 

 

Декiлька DHCP по /24 замiсть одного /16 потрiбно, щоб була хоча б якась структура розподiлу IP адресiв (наприклад 1.0 для вулицi Артема, 2.0 для Пушкина и т.д.)

Брєд сивої кобили.

 

http://wiki.ubilling.net.ua/doku.php?id=faq

 

Мы считаем, что ручная фигурная расстановка IP по феншую и пророческое угадывание незанятых - это не то чем занимается адекватный администратор.

 

 

 

З Вашоi вiдповiдi, ще раз зрозумiв, що навiть якщо в мене декiлька пiдмереж, та "фiзично" усього один NAS, то я кожен раз буду його вказувати.

Звичайно. Не буде він вгадувати де ваші юзера фізично обслуговуються.

 

 

Питання про MAC-адресу ще актуальне!!

http://wiki.ubilling.net.ua/doku.php?id=bsddhcpd

Link to post
Share on other sites

С уважаемыми разработчиками не поспоришь - бред , конечно, но если очень хочется.... рисуете алиасы для сетей вида /24 ,  в услуге обзываете каждую сеть "Internrt 1.0 для вулицi Артема", "Internet 2.0 для вулицi Пушкина" и рассовуете абонентов по услугам. Не кидайте камнями , но у нас так разделены направления, их 4.

Link to post
Share on other sites

 

 

в услуге обзываете каждую сеть "Internrt 1.0 для вулицi Артема", "Internet 2.0 для вулицi Пушкина" и рассовуете абонентов по услугам.

Ну типа того. Очевидно продиктовано спецификой уровня доступа. В любом случае меня коробит не от самой сегментации - это очень позитивно. А от замашек некоторых, вида "давайте каждой улице/дому/подъезду/этажу свою подсеть, ну типа что-бы было, так красиво типа".

Link to post
Share on other sites

И окажется , что подсетей больше чем живых пользователей и разберись потом в этом ворохе. Красиво - это когда кратко и логично.

Link to post
Share on other sites

 

 

И окажется , что подсетей больше чем живых пользователей и разберись потом в этом ворохе. Красиво - это когда кратко и логично.

Красиво, это когда это нужно и функционально обосновано.

Если "просто расстановки ради расстановок" -  это просто фестиваль шизофрении.

Link to post
Share on other sites

маєм глюк

при заміні МАК в арп листі висить старий мак

freeBSD 9.3 0.7.1 rev 4768 все в однім флаконі

 

ресет не міняє ситуацію, міняє заміна тарифу

3psTu09.png

3psTNv7.png

3psUe4N.png

Edited by mgo
Link to post
Share on other sites
при заміні МАК в арп листі висить старий мак

2.409? Пробуйте вимкнути RESET_AO та потицькайте ресет, зирячи при цьому в tail -F /var/stargazer/allconnect.log

Edited by nightfly
Link to post
Share on other sites
2.409? Пробуйте вимкнути RESET_AO та потицькайте ресет, зирячи при цьому в tail -F /var/stargazer/allconnect.log

він самий з поденнов АП))

йду тицяти,  RESET_AO =1 зістарту втикнув, бо на віддалених NAS-rscriptd спецефекти

-----------------------------------------------------------------------------------------------------------------------------------------------

RESET_AO =1 ресет в tail -F /var/stargazer/allconnect.log несиплеться

RESET_AO =0 ресет в tail -F /var/stargazer/allconnect.log Є!

Edited by mgo
Link to post
Share on other sites

 

йду тицяти,  RESET_AO =1 зістарту втикнув, бо на віддалених NAS-rscriptd спецефекти

Ну тепер по ідеї навпаки :)

 

RESET_AO =0 ресет в tail -F /var/stargazer/allconnect.log Є!

Значить так і має бути.

Edited by nightfly
Link to post
Share on other sites

Привіт . Що це за функція  ? і як вона повинна показувати в профілі користувача онлайн ? 
 

Определение онлайна пользователя и показ в профиле пользователя
VLAN_ONLINE_IN_PROFILE=0

Link to post
Share on other sites

Привіт . Що це за функція  ? і як вона повинна показувати в профілі користувача онлайн ? 

 

Определение онлайна пользователя и показ в профиле пользователя

VLAN_ONLINE_IN_PROFILE=0

если используешь мои вланы - оно смотрил на циске выдало ли юзеру дхцп адрес в его влане, если выдало значит онлнай

Link to post
Share on other sites

 

Привіт . Що це за функція  ? і як вона повинна показувати в профілі користувача онлайн ? 

 

Определение онлайна пользователя и показ в профиле пользователя

VLAN_ONLINE_IN_PROFILE=0

если используешь мои вланы - оно смотрил на циске выдало ли юзеру дхцп адрес в его влане, если выдало значит онлнай

 

Привет.  можете помочь с статусом онлайн "звездочками"

DN_ONLINE_DETECT=1

в OnConnect/OnDisconnect добавил: 

OnConnect   /bin/echo $SPEED:`expr $ID + 4101` > /etc/stargazer/dn/$LOGIN

OnDisconnect    /bin/rm /etc/stargazer/dn/$LOGIN

Добавил просто с верху тк не знаю куда их нужно добавлять) если не сложно поделитесь содержимым OnConnect/OnDisconnect

​с симлинком тоже проблема ln -fs /etc/stargazer/dn/ /var/www/billing/content/dn у меня просто нет такого пути /var/www/billing/content/dn ну и саих каталогов dn

при обновлении DN_ONLINE_LINKING="YES" 

=== Linking True Online ===

0.7.2 rev 4856
===Update complete ===
Edited by 49rpam
Link to post
Share on other sites

 

 

Привіт . Що це за функція  ? і як вона повинна показувати в профілі користувача онлайн ? 

 

Определение онлайна пользователя и показ в профиле пользователя

VLAN_ONLINE_IN_PROFILE=0

если используешь мои вланы - оно смотрил на циске выдало ли юзеру дхцп адрес в его влане, если выдало значит онлнай

 

Привет.  можете помочь с статусом онлайн "звездочками"

DN_ONLINE_DETECT=1

в OnConnect/OnDisconnect добавил: 

OnConnect   /bin/echo $SPEED:`expr $ID + 4101` > /etc/stargazer/dn/$LOGIN

OnDisconnect    /bin/rm /etc/stargazer/dn/$LOGIN

Добавил просто с верху тк не знаю куда их нужно добавлять) если не сложно поделитесь содержимым OnConnect/OnDisconnect

​с симлинком тоже проблема ln -fs /etc/stargazer/dn/ /var/www/billing/content/dn у меня просто нет такого пути /var/www/billing/content/dn ну и саих каталогов dn

при обновлении DN_ONLINE_LINKING="YES" 

=== Linking True Online ===

0.7.2 rev 4856
===Update complete ===

 

изучай:

http://local.com.ua/forum/topic/43565-ubilling-nas-%D0%BD%D0%B0-freebsd-%D0%B1%D0%BE%D1%80%D1%82%D0%B6%D1%83%D1%80%D0%BD%D0%B0%D0%BB-%D0%BF%D0%BE%D1%87%D0%B8%D0%BD%D0%B0%D1%8E%D1%87%D0%BE%D0%B3%D0%BE-%D0%B0%D0%B4%D0%BC%D1%96%D0%BD%D0%B0/page-48?hl=fullhostscan

и еще это:

http://wiki.ubilling.net.ua/doku.php?id=remoteapi

Edited by a_n_h
Link to post
Share on other sites

Не глухо не понимаю

что глухо? что не понятно?

это:

  • fullhostscan + param [traffdiff] - опрос всех клиентов из подсетей указанных в справочнике «Сети и сервисы» при помощи nmap а также при указании параметра traffdiff пытается анализировать активность по изменениям трафика.
понятно?
Link to post
Share on other sites

купив дятько NAS з абонентами, десь під 50 рил і абоненти підписані так, що відомо тілько тому хто то там підписував.

ні адреси, ні телефона ні нормального імені нема(

 

вирішили через UHW ото переловити

 

проблема, MAC з виберушки швидко зникає

що зробити можна?

час оренди 1-2 хв ставити?

Edited by mgo
Link to post
Share on other sites

у мене JSON просто мусить зламатися!

онлайн поламався((

 

3pJJjSK.png

 

то приват ламався тут, то JSON раз, тепер ще раз

карма тут погана(

 

блін спешка((

вже бачу як поламав

Edited by mgo
Link to post
Share on other sites

 

 

у мене JSON просто мусить зламатися!

0.7.1 - знову привіт некрофілам :)

 

http://wiki.ubilling.net.ua/doku.php?id=changelog

 

  • Модуль «OpenPayz»: исправлено фильтрование адресов в списке транзакций.
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Recently Browsing   0 members

    No registered users viewing this page.

  • Similar Content

    • By Andrey75
      Всем доброго дня!
      не могу разобраться:
      создал NAS для работы с cisco, в нем есть например два атрибута:

       
      когда очищаем все атрибуты и делаем регенерацию в  mlg_reply есть оба, но после повторной регенерации (либо кнопкой в управлении NAS, либо через crontab) остается один.
      как я понял остается один атрибут из всех с одинаковым значением "Атрибут" в таблице, не зависимо от отличий в "операторах" и "значениях"
      NAS:

       

       
      все еще в процессе настройки
       
       
       
       
    • By camchatix
      Привет!
       
      Начались необъяснимые глюки с базой ubilling
      сделали mysqldump на старой базе 5.6.36
      На свежей freebsd mysql server 5.6.51
      сделали импорт - и в карточке при обновлении страницы баланс показывает то одну цифру то другую
       
      подскажите как такое может быть и как вылечить ?
       
      вот -126 денег это правильно
       
      mysql> select login,D0,U0,Cash, LastCashAddTime   from users where login=65369051; +----------+------------+------------+---------+-----------------+ | login    | D0         | U0         | Cash    | LastCashAddTime | +----------+------------+------------+---------+-----------------+ | 65369051 | 3619373056 | 4680515584 | -126.07 |      1634677205 | +----------+------------+------------+---------+-----------------+ 1 row in set, 1 warning (0.00 sec)  
      через 3 минуты
      mysql> select login,D0,U0,Cash, LastCashAddTime from users where login=65369051; +----------+------------+------------+-------+-----------------+ | login | D0 | U0 | Cash | LastCashAddTime | +----------+------------+------------+-------+-----------------+ | 65369051 | 3555340288 | 3879243776 | 36.61 | 1634677203 | +----------+------------+------------+-------+-----------------+ 1 row in set, 1 warning (0.00 sec)  
      а тут 36 денег
      Как такое может быть ?
       
       
       
       
    • By ppv
      Підкажіть будь ласка щось не працює параметр, або я щось не розумію. Якщо абонплата 100 грн. (для прикладу) то, якщо  AUTOFREEZE_CASH_LIMIT="-2"  то морозити буде пр стані рахунку -200 грн. і 300 грн. і дальше в мінус ?
       
      Порог денег (отрицательный) для автозаморозки пользователя. Работает только при вызове из remote API. При использовании вызова autofreezemonth данная опция рассматривается как множитель (положительный) стоимости тарифа пользователя. Пользователь будет заморожен при состоянии счета ⇐ стоимости его тарифа умноженного на значение опции. AUTOFREEZE_CASH_LIMIT="-2" в кроні  запускається (завдання спрацьовує).
      /usr/local/bin/curl -o /dev/null "http://127.0.0.1:1111/billing/?module=remoteapi&key=1111111111111111111111111111111&action=autofreezemonth&param=nocredit"  
    • By DimaXYZ
      Преамбула: давно читаю форум, поэтому понимаю, что пошлют в wiki, но и его я читал перечитал ... Пару лет читаю/перечитываю. но всеже попробую задать вопрос, может кто-то ответит ламеру.
       
      Никак не могу заставить отправлять сообщения в telegram.
      Сделано:
      1. В telegram:
      а) Зарегестрирован бот через папу ботов.
      б) Создана группа и туда этот бот добавлен. На всякий случай как администратор.
      в) из личного аккаунта помахал ручкой в личку боту
      3. В Ubilling:
      а) в собаке-посылаке вписал токен бота
      б) нажал "лупу" и увидел 2 id чатов и последние сообщения в этих чатах (т.е. все вроде ОК)
      в) в очереди сообщений telegram жму + и создаю новое сообщение указав id чата взятый из предыдущего пункта. Сообщение появляется в очереди.
       
      иии.... все. Сообщения в телеграм не приходят . Что я сделал не так или не доделал?
       
      На всякий случай: в cron есть запись. Также пытался вручную запускать.
      */5 * * * *     /bin/ubapi "senddog"
    • By Brilliantovaya_Ruka
      Добрый день.
      Есть желание отказаться от самописного биллинга.
      Присматриваемся к Ubilling. 
      Кто пользуется этим биллингом поделитесь опытом пожалуйста.
      Интересует всё: плюсы/минусы, подводные камни и т.п. 
       

×
×
  • Create New...